The PCF8575DWR from Texas Instruments is a 16-bit quasi-bidirectional I/O expander that communicates via the I2C interface. This device is suitable for applications requiring additional I/O pins, offering 16 general-purpose inputs/outputs that can be controlled by a microcontroller. It operates within a voltage range of 2.5V to 5.5V and supports a maximum clock frequency of 400kHz.
The expander features an interrupt output pin, which can be configured as open-drain, to signal changes in I/O states. The latched outputs provide high-current drive capability, allowing for direct driving of LEDs. The device is available in a 24-SOIC package, designed for surface mounting.
With its low standby current consumption and compatibility with most microcontrollers, the PCF8575DWR is a versatile solution for expanding I/O capabilities in embedded systems. The address can be set using three hardware address pins, enabling up to eight devices on the same I2C bus.
